Transaction 683dc123af7593cfe6de94bdedccdbfb50d269205422b7d4fc9a9e60b6c3ccb7
1 Input
1 Output
-
683dc123af7593cfe6de94bdedccdbfb50d269205422b7d4fc9a9e60b6c3ccb7:0
- value
- 489162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4920321bd495fe440a3e0bfdc98c62181345798 OP_EQUAL
- address
- 3NXauPWdJiAESApX2AbXsg31BHGQhyHvry